Celebrate Independence Day in song!

Special features of the performance include a rousing salute to the armed forces with representatives from all branches. Other musical highlights include exciting musical arrangements composed for the Mormon Tabernacle Choir, numerous Broadway and Pops tunes, two Gershwin medleys, and guest soloists Chris Kelsey and Jacquelyn Cruz.  The high energy performance is suitable for all ages and is a wonderful way to begin your Fourth of July celebrations.
